Abstract

      A significant shift toward incorporating sustainable practices into packaging design with the increasing concerns about environmental sustainability. Sophisticated frameworks or tactics are necessary to lessen the increasing environmental impact of packaging waste. However, there are numerous opportunities to reduce waste and use more sustainable packaging design (SPD) techniques despite these initiatives. To address the need for a holistic strategy, this study introduces a comprehensive approach to sustainable packaging design. This technique covers packaging systems and packaged goods across the entire supply chain starting from the producer to the final consumer. This is presented as a strategic blueprint that aims to achieve not only more efficient but also more sustainable. It will provide a holistic perspective based on identified attributes on what constitutes a sustainable packaging solution. The approach incorporates several distinct analytical methods that ensure cost-effectiveness. The methodology is intended to be a practical tool for the packaging Industry and designers who seek to enhance sustainability within their packaging systems. Experts were selected from industry, academia and entrepreneurial background to enhance robustness of the proposed methodology. Moreover, attributes of this framework were validated on the Kano model that analysed whether its strength and relevance possessed significant impacts towards sustainable packaging design. The findings of this research will contribute to the development of a comprehensive framework for sustainable packaging design. These attributes will offer valuable guidance to manufacturers, designers, and companies seeking to prioritize sustainability in their operations. By providing a structured approach to decision-making, it aims to empower stakeholders to make well-informed choices that align with environmental goals and improve the overall sustainability of packaging systems.
